Sophomores Continue Journey Through High School Years The Sophomores began their second year at PCHS by electing their student council representatives and class officers. The class officers were: President Lisa Houghland, Vice-President Lisa Fleming and Secretary-Treasurer Bonnie Fulk, Student council representatives were Rosie Brand, Ralph Loos, Eric Thomas, Matt Mason and Jeanne Spurgeon The Sophs participated in all of the Homecoming activities. From their class, Fred Holland led an incredi- ble Michael Jackson performance, and few acts “Beat It” for excitement. Sophs also entered a float in the homecoming parade and were represented on the court by Kelly Hawkins Just before Christmas, the Sophs completed their annual jewelry sale to build their class treasury in an- ticipation of putting on the prom next year. Charla Boling, Troy Pabst and Aaron Robinson were the top three salespeople. Also at this time, many sophomores attended and enjoyed the Christmas Dance where they were represented by Staci Starkweather and Ralph Loos. In February, Debbie Ross was a member of the Sweetheart Dance Court. Springtime meant the annual record and tape sale Sophomore year meant continuing a journey through high school life, moving up to English Il, possibly Geometry or Social Science, fulfilling their Health class requirement and getting their anxiously awaited driver's license Not Pictured: Darlene McCosky Sophomore Class Officers — Left to Right: Vice-President Lisa Fleming, President Lisa Houghland, Secretary Bonnie Fulk 20 SOPHOMORES
